Days 1–3 Weather Summary

A heavy fall of snow, heaviest during Wed night. Temperatures will be well below freezing (max -6°C on Wed night, min -16°C on Tue morning). Winds increasing (moderate winds from the W on Tue morning, extremely windy from the W by Wed night).

Days 4–6 Weather Summary

A heavy fall of snow, heaviest during Fri morning. Temperatures will be well below freezing (max -8°C on Fri morning, min -19°C on Sat night). Winds increasing (calm on Fri night, strong winds from the W by Sun night).
